Day 1: Welcome to Lima — City of Kings & The Larco Museum Arrive at Lima airport; meet-and-greet assistance and private transfer to your hotel. Afternoon:Historical Center of Lima: Guided walking tour of the UNESCO World Heritage historical core. Convent of Santo Domingo: Explore the site where the Universidad Mayor de San Marcos (oldest in the Americas) was founded. View the historic library, the choir stalls, and the tombs of San Martín de Porres, San Juan Masías, and Santa Rosa de Lima. Plaza Mayor: Visit the Cathedral of Lima. Late Afternoon / Evening: Larco Museum: Explore pre-Columbian gold collections, and erotic ceramics that illustrate ancient Peruvian cosmovision. Includes special access to the museum’s open storage warehouse. Overnight: Lima
Day 2: Imperial Cusco & Historic Center Morning Transfer to Lima airport for your flight to Cusco. Arrival assistance and hotel check-in. Afternoon San Cristóbal Square: Panoramic view of Cusco. San Pedro Market: Guided walk through the bustling local market. Qorikancha (Temple of the Sun): Tour the premier Inca temple. San Blas & Hatun Rumiyoc: Stroll through the artisan and historic district to view the Twelve-Angled Stone. Plaza de Armas & Cathedral: Visit the central square and the Cathedral housing priceless colonial art. Overnight: Cusco
Day 3: Cusco – From Cusco you will directly go to to the Sacred Valley of the Incas for a Excursion Numerous ruins of ancient cities lie in the Sacred Valley of the Incas: Pisac, Ollantaytambo, Chinchero, Urubamba. At the artisan market in Pisac, you can buy local handicrafts — ceramics, carpets, souvenirs, silver and leather goods. At the Awanakancha Zoo Center, visitors enjoy feeding charming llamas, alpacas, guanacos and vicuñas, and learn about the process of preparing and naturally dyeing wool. Continue to the archaeological complex of Ollantaytambo, Buffet lunch at the national cuisine restaurant Tunupa. Overnight Sacred Valley hotel.
Day 4: Machu Picchu — The Lost City of the Incas Morning: Breakfast at the hotel. Full-day excursion to Machu Picchu – the “lost city of the Incas” in a group with an English -speaking guide. The most enlightened priests went to Machu Picchu after the fall of the Inca Empire; the Spaniards could not find this city. Machu Picchu was built of huge limestone blocks without the use of cementing mortar on the top of a mountain, surrounded by impenetrable jungle. It was discovered by the American archaeologist Iram Bingham only in 1911. Dinner. Return to Cusco by train. Arrival, transfer to Cuscohotel.
Day 5: Departure & Farewell Morning / Day: In the afternoon we will get away from the crowds to visit Sacsayhuaman, an impressive citadel full of colossal constructions surrounded by beautiful landscapes in complete communion with nature. Climb to the Archaeological park of Sacsayhuaman, in the higher part of Cusco. Our first stop will be Tambomachay, a source of spring water that it is believed was once worshipped. Next we will visit the remains of Qenqo, a stone made labyrinth with a sacrificial altar in its center. At the Fortress of Sacsayhuaman we will enjoy a wonderful view of Cusco while admiring the massive stones that make up the fortress. Our last stop will be to see the Tower of Pucca Pucara before transferring back to the city and your hotel. After that transfer to the airport for your flight home
